Output 51485b12998f845a159c8b44f24c847a6c6b20b23d6eb8b2ae052028863eb715:0

value
3467938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 546c382afe23b1e6b77d52bffde7301d31e7738c OP_EQUAL
address
MFbYdm3D8FdyJbr6seE2s6MYiDSxmP1fta
transaction
51485b12998f845a159c8b44f24c847a6c6b20b23d6eb8b2ae052028863eb715
spent
true